United Response is seeking a Technology Delivery Partner to work remotely in the UK. This role involves managing a portfolio of technology products and ensuring smooth delivery aligned to organizational standards.

Candidates should have experience in technology delivery within a complex environment, strong stakeholder management skills, and a track record with third-party applications.

Benefits include:

  • Generous annual leave
  • A workplace pension scheme
  • A commitment to support individuals with disabilities
